What Is Food Noise?
Food noise is different from simply thinking about food.
Everyone thinks about food. You decide what to make for dinner, notice that you're hungry, remember something you need at the grocery store, or look forward to eating at your favorite restaurant.
Food noise generally refers to food-related thoughts that feel persistent, intrusive, difficult to ignore, or disruptive.
Scientific interest in the concept is relatively new. A 2025 expert-panel paper described food noise as persistent food thoughts perceived as unwanted or distressing that may contribute to social, mental, or physical problems. Researchers distinguished it from ordinary thoughts about food primarily by its intensity and intrusiveness.
That distinction matters.
Thinking, "What should I make for dinner tonight?" is normal.
Feeling as though thoughts about food are constantly competing for your attention can be a very different experience.
Is Food Noise a Medical Diagnosis?
No.
Food noise is a relatively new concept in scientific research, and it should not be treated as a medical diagnosis.
In fact, researchers are still working to define exactly what food noise represents, how it should be measured, how it relates to appetite and food-cue reactivity, and how important it may be for weight management. Early researchers studying the concept have emphasized that more work is needed.
That is important context because the term has become popular online much faster than the science surrounding it has developed.
At the same time, something doesn't have to be a diagnosis for your personal experience to be worth noticing.
If food thoughts occupy a large amount of your attention before starting a GLP-1 medication and later feel noticeably different, that can be meaningful information about your experience—even if it doesn't tell you anything by itself about how much weight you will lose.
Why Are People Talking About Food Noise and GLP-1s?
Much of the attention around food noise came from people using GLP-1 receptor agonists who described an unexpected change: they were thinking about food less.
Researchers began taking notice.
A 2023 scientific review discussing food noise noted anecdotal reports from patients and clinicians describing less rumination and obsessive preoccupation with food after treatment with GLP-1 receptor agonists such as semaglutide.
Since then, research has begun moving beyond anecdotes.
A randomized six-week study published in 2025 found that tirzepatide reduced several measures related to eating behavior compared with placebo, including overall appetite, food cravings, perceived hunger, tendency to overeat, and reactivity to food in the environment. Those concepts are not identical to "food noise," but the findings help researchers understand some of the eating-behavior changes people may experience during treatment.
More recently, researchers have started studying food noise directly.
What Does the Research Say About Semaglutide and Food Noise?
One particularly relevant study was published in 2026 and surveyed 550 U.S. adults using injectable semaglutide for weight management.
Participants completed a Food Noise Questionnaire and were asked to recall their food-noise experience before beginning semaglutide and describe their current experience. The median questionnaire score based on their recollection before treatment was 13 out of 20. After starting semaglutide, the median score was 6.
That's interesting evidence, but there is an important limitation.
This was a retrospective, cross-sectional survey. Participants were being asked to remember how they felt before beginning treatment rather than researchers measuring food noise before treatment and then prospectively following the same measure over time. The authors themselves concluded that prospective, longitudinal research is still needed. The study also involved researchers affiliated with Novo Nordisk, the manufacturer of semaglutide products, so that funding and conflict-of-interest context is worth noting when interpreting the findings.
So the responsible conclusion isn't:
"Semaglutide eliminates food noise."
It's that early research supports something patients have been describing for years: food-related thoughts may change during GLP-1 treatment, and researchers are now trying to understand and measure those changes more carefully.
Food Noise Isn't the Same as Hunger
This distinction is especially important.
Hunger is a normal biological signal.
Food noise describes the mental experience surrounding food-related thoughts.
The two can overlap, but they are not necessarily the same thing.
You can be physically hungry and think about food because your body needs nourishment. You can also experience food-related thoughts even when you don't feel particularly hungry.
This is one reason tracking food noise separately from meals or hunger can be useful.
If you simply write down what you ate, you know what happened.
If you also record how much mental attention food was demanding that week, you begin recording something different: your experience around eating.

Researchers Are Developing Ways to Measure Food Noise Too
Interestingly, scientists have been working on exactly this problem: how do you measure something as subjective as food noise?
Researchers have developed questionnaires designed to quantify food-noise experiences. One five-item Food Noise Questionnaire has undergone psychometric testing, with researchers reporting evidence supporting its reliability and validity as a research measurement tool. They also emphasized that further study is needed to determine its clinical usefulness across different populations and during weight-loss treatment.
That doesn't mean you need a clinical questionnaire in your personal journal.
But it reinforces an important idea: subjective experiences can become easier to understand when they are recorded consistently.

Look for Patterns, Not Explanations
This is one of the most important rules when tracking subjective experiences.
Your journal can show you a pattern.
It cannot necessarily explain the pattern.
Suppose you notice that your food-noise rating was lower for several weeks and then increased.
There could be many possible explanations. Your routines may have changed. You might be sleeping differently. Stress may be higher. Your eating patterns may have changed. Your treatment may have changed under your clinician's direction. Or something else entirely may be happening.
A journal cannot determine the cause.
What it can do is help you notice that something changed.
That distinction keeps tracking useful without turning it into self-diagnosis.

Food Noise Isn't a Score You Need to "Win"
Tracking can become counterproductive if every measurement turns into another test.
You do not need to achieve a food-noise score of zero.
You don't need your rating to decrease every week.
And you should not interpret a particular rating as evidence that your medication dose needs to change.
Food noise is an emerging research concept, not a dosing tool.
Your rating is simply a personal observation.
Treat it like information rather than a grade.
That approach is consistent with research examining people's experiences with self-monitoring during weight-loss attempts. A systematic review of qualitative studies found that how people interpret tracking data matters; researchers suggested framing self-monitoring as a tool for analysis rather than something that fuels shame or negative self-perception.
Curiosity is much more useful than judgment.
